Mild earthquake shakes Bukit Kepong, tremors felt across Johor and Melaka, says MetMalaysia


KUALA LUMPUR: A weak magnitude 3.4 earthquake occurred in Bukit Kepong, Pagoh, Johor at 8.55am, on Sunday (Dec 28).

In a statement on Sunday, the Malaysian Meteorological Department (MetMalaysia) said the epicentre of the earthquake was located 2.4°North and 102.7° East with a depth of 10km, 16km Southwest of Segamat, Johor.

“Tremors were felt in several areas in Johor and Melaka.

“The Malaysian Meteorological Department will continue to monitor the situation,” it said in the statement.
